Cell subpopulations in the paracortical area of the normal human lymphnode defined by monoclonal antibodies.

Abstract

The cell subpopulations of normal human lymphnode were studied by immunohistochemical and immunoelectronmicroscopy techniques carried out by using monoclonal antibodies. OKT3 positive cells were demonstrated overwhelming in comparison to both OKT4 positive cells and OKT8 positive cells; furthermore la positive cells, dendritic in shape, were observed. Our results, compared to literature data, confirm that paracortex of limphnode is a T-dependent area. Moreover a possible role of the la positive dendritic cells in the immunological education of T helper-inducer lymphocytes was hypotised. Finally, our immunoelectronmicroscopic findings prove that OKT4 positive cells and OKT8 positive cells show different ultrastructural patterns.

运用单克隆抗体通过免疫组织化学和免疫电子显微镜技术研究了正常人淋巴结的细胞亚群。结果显示,与OKT4阳性细胞和OKT8阳性细胞相比,OKT3阳性细胞占绝大多数;此外,还观察到呈树突状的la阳性细胞。与文献数据相比,我们的结果证实淋巴结副皮质区是T细胞依赖区。此外,推测la阳性树突状细胞在辅助性T诱导淋巴细胞的免疫教育中可能发挥作用。最后,我们的免疫电子显微镜研究结果证明OKT4阳性细胞和OKT8阳性细胞呈现出不同的超微结构模式。
